Big Ideas & Topics in Kindergarten Math

  • The big ideas and topics in Kindergarten are understanding counting and cardinality, understanding addition as joining and subtraction as separating, and comparing objects by measurable attributes.

    Students develop number and operations through several fundamental concepts. Students know number names and the counting sequence. Counting and cardinality lay a solid foundation for number. Students apply the principles of counting to make the connection between numbers and quantities.

    Students use meanings of numbers to create strategies for solving problems and responding to practical situations involving addition and subtraction.
